About Dee Why 2099

The size of Dee Why is approximately 3.4 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 15.0% of total area. The population of Dee Why in 2016 was 21518 people. By 2021 the population was 23354 showing a population growth of 8.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dee Why is 30-39 years. Households in Dee Why are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dee Why work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 50.20% of the homes in Dee Why were owner-occupied compared with 50.30% in 2016.

Dee Why has 13,232 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Dee Why have seen a 25.54%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 26.09% increase. As at 31 March 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Dee Why is $2,835,669 while the median value for Units is $1,121,092.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,300 while Units have a median rent of $780.
